Abstract :
There are many configurations of permanent magnet machine, some of them are more significant than others. Machines are most commonly 3-phase but single phase capacitor start and run designs can be very effective. There is an ever widening choice of magnet materials available, but the most useful are the ferrites and the rare earths, whether samarium cobalt or neodymium-iron-boron. The choice of magnet depends on the specification, with initial cost and operating temperature having an important role. The author examines motor characteristics for three types of permanent magnet synchronous motors and assesses the cost effectiveness of each type
